This is a story about Sal and Vanessa, who despite rough starts in life, find love with each other. He is an ex-con who got into jail due to gang activities and she is a young single mom struggling to make ends. They meet again (they knew each other growing up) when he is forced out of the house where he was sleeping on a couch and he needs somewhere else to stay to save money for his own place. Vanessa’s grandmother decides to rent him the garage. Vanessa is not happy at first when she learns he will be living in her home and he has a key for the house.
This story was written well and I did somewhat enjoy it, but I couldn’t really get into it due to the gang aspect. I thought it would just touch on it, but it is a big part of this book. The main part.
